About Uralba

Uralba is a small rural locality in the Northern Rivers region of New South Wales, situated within the Ballina Shire approximately 10 kilometres west of Ballina. With a 2021 Census population of 266 residents across around 11.6 square kilometres, Uralba is characterised by its peaceful rural setting of low-lying farmland and remnant subtropical vegetation. The locality sits in the fertile Richmond River catchment and benefits from the mild, subtropical climate of the Northern Rivers. It falls within the federal electorate of Richmond, reflecting its position in the Far North Coast of NSW.

Residents of Uralba enjoy the relaxed lifestyle of the Northern Rivers, with easy access to the facilities of nearby Ballina and the vibrant town of Lismore to the west. The area is predominantly acreage and small farms, attracting families and tree-changers seeking space and tranquillity while remaining within commuting distance of coastal services. The nearby Ballina CBD offers shopping, schools, health services and the beach, while the broader Northern Rivers region is renowned for its arts scene, markets and natural beauty. Residents often draw on both Ballina and Lismore for urban amenities.

Uralba falls under postcode 2477 and is governed by the Ballina Council (Local Government Area). For federal elections, residents vote in the electorate of Richmond, while state elections fall under the Lismore electorate.
